Panic at the gas pump; and, the growth of narcissism
0:08 – We revisit the oil and energy shocks of 1973 and 1979, all the way up to the Gulf War in 1990 with Dr. Meg Jacobs, Research Scholar teaching courses in public policy and history at Princeton University and author of Panic at the Pump: The Energy Crisis and the Transformation of American Politics in the 1970s.
0:33 – Narcissism appears to be on the rise in the US. Rahmana Finney (@rahmanafinney) offers a unique perspective from a cultural angle, as the author of the new book The Beautiful Enemy: America’s Narcissism Epidemic.
